well... me talking about my sis helps me. and me helping other people helps me.

but i did go with a guy who was a drunk. and while he was going to AA, i was going to Al-anon (for family/spouses of alcholics). When i was at my meeting, they told me that i had to improve MYSELF and work on MYSELF. it was a good concept i guess, everyone needs work. but i was told that if I became a better person, then he would see this and want to improve himself and stop drinking. I was pissed and offended! i was like, "he drank LONG before he met me. his drinking has nothin to do with me---he's a drunk. that is what they do. I was a good person who cared about people--- how could they tell me that i had something wrong with me? the problem was his!"

so to me, the person in the relationship that was trying to help, was actually taking/accepting blame for the actions of the drunk--- NOT right!
